The Jeanneau Sun Odyssey 50 DS is widely regarded as one of the most successful large cruising yachts of her era, combining excellent sailing performance with the comfort and light of a true deck saloon design. Freespirit is a particularly appealing example, finished with the desirable flag blue hull and benefiting from careful ownership throughout her life. This particular yachts has had only 3 owners from new.
Designed by Philippe Briand with interiors by Garroni, the 50 DS offers a spacious and welcoming layout, with a raised saloon providing panoramic views and excellent natural light. The three-cabin, two-heads configuration offers generous accommodation, including a well-appointed owner’s cabin forward and two comfortable aft cabins, making her well suited to family cruising or extended time aboard.
On deck, the cockpit is cleverly arranged into distinct areas for sailing, dining and relaxation, with twin wheels, teak seating, folding cockpit table and excellent access around the boat. Sailing systems are well specified, with electric winches, rigid vang and an extensive sail wardrobe including Code 0 and staysail arrangements.
Recent ownership has focused on sensible upgrades and maintenance, including new batteries, saildrive clutch replacement, solar charging, watermaker installation and improved ground tackle. The addition of a Highfield tender with electric outboard further enhances her cruising credentials.
Currently berthed in Marina Fertilia near Alghero, Sardinia, Freespirit represents a well-equipped and thoughtfully maintained example of this popular deck saloon cruiser.
